#1a54f9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1a54f9 is composed of 10.2% red, 32.9%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.6% cyan, 66.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 224.4 degrees, a saturation of 94.9% and a lightness of 53.9%. #1a54f9 color hex could be obtained by blending #34a8ff with #0000f3.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#1a54f9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1a54f9 has RGB values of R:26, G:84, B:249 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 1725689.

Shades and Tints of #1a54f9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#ecf1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1a54f9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#86888d is the less saturated color, while #1a54f9 is the most saturated one.
